Local citations, in essence, are online mentions of a business that include relevant information such as the name, address, phone number (NAP), customer reviews, and business hours. These citations can originate from various sources, including directory listings, social media platforms, review sites, blogs, and news articles. They play a vital role in improving local search engine optimization (SEO) by verifying the accuracy of business information and establishing its relevance and authority within the local community. The more citations a business has, the higher the likelihood of appearing at the top of local search results, ultimately driving more website traffic.

Local citations can be classified into three main categories:

Local Listings: These are directories and websites that focus on a specific geographic area. Examples include Yelp, Yellow Pages, and Google Business Profile.

Data Aggregators: Data aggregators, such as Neustar Localeze and Data Axle, distribute business information to a network of sites and directories for a fee. Services like BrightLocal simplify the process by submitting to major data aggregator networks.

Industry-Specific/Niche Sites: These sites publish listings that are directly relevant to businesses in specific industries. Examples include Zillow for real estate agents and Avvo for lawyers.

Now, let’s explore why local citation building is crucial for businesses and how it can boost brand visibility in local markets:

Enhanced SEO: Local citations play a pivotal role in improving SEO by increasing a business’s online visibility. Search engines like Google cross-reference business information across various sources to determine its consistency and reliability. Consistent information across different platforms helps establish trust and credibility, leading to better local rankings in search results.

Increased Trust and Authority: Accurate and reliable local citations act as trust signals to search engines and potential customers. When business information is consistent and verified, customers are more likely to trust the brand and choose its products or services. Trust and authority play a significant role in attracting customers and differentiating a business from competitors.

Targeted Local Exposure: Local citations enable businesses to target specific local markets effectively. By appearing in local search results, businesses can reach potential customers who are actively seeking products or services in their vicinity. This targeted exposure increases the chances of attracting local customers and driving foot traffic to physical stores or website visits.

Now that we understand the importance of local citations let’s explore five tips to build them effectively:

Consistency and Accuracy: Ensure that your business’s NAP information (name, address, and phone number) is consistent across all citations. Inaccurate or inconsistent information can confuse search engines and potential customers, negatively impacting your online visibility.

Claim and Optimize Listings: Claim your business listings on major directories and platforms. Optimize your profiles by providing complete and detailed information about your business. Add relevant images, business descriptions, categories served, and customer reviews where applicable. Completing profiles helps improve visibility and provides customers with comprehensive information about your brand.

Leverage Data Aggregators: Utilize data aggregator services to distribute accurate business information to a network of sites and directories. This simplifies the citation-building process and ensures widespread visibility across platforms.

Industry-Specific/Niche Sites: Identify industry-specific or niche sites relevant to your business and create citations on those platforms. Targeting specialized platforms enhances the relevance and visibility of your brand within your specific industry.

Monitor and Manage Citations: Regularly monitor your existing citations to identify any inaccuracies or outdated information. Update or remove incorrect citations promptly to maintain consistency and accuracy across the internet. Additionally, consider using local citation management services or tools to streamline the process.
